
The Xbox 360 might reign supreme in the game department, but from a hardware perspective it stills falls short when compared to the PS3. You’re probably think I’m talking about Blu-ray, right? Wrongzo. I’m talking about the lack of built-in WiFi. And it now looks like you’re gonna have to drop a pretty penny if you want your 360 to have the latest and greatest in wireless connectivity, because Gamestop currently lists the Xbox 360 Wireless N Networking Adapter for $100. If you commit now you can expect it to ship 11/3, but seeing as it costs 1/3 as much as a brand new Elite system I’d suggest you take a big fat pass.
